Summary

On 6 September 1989 at about 21:24 local time, a North American F-51 registered N51VP, operated by Vernon Peterson, was involved in an accident near Denton, Texas, United States. 2 people were on board and one died, one had minor injuries. The aircraft was destroyed. The NTSB has published a probable cause for this accident; it is quoted in full below.

Probable cause

THE PILOT'S FAILURE TO DETECT WATER IN THE FUEL SYSTEM DURING THE PREFLIGHT WHICH SUBSEQUENTLY RESULTED IN A LOSS OF POWER.

Quoted verbatim from the NTSB record. This site does not paraphrase or interpret it.

Read the full NTSB narrative

THE PILOT TAXIED THE AIRCRAFT TO THE DEPARTURE RUNWAY AND PERFORMED A NORMAL PRE-TAKEOFF RUN UP. THE AIRCRAFT WAS VIEWED BY NUMEROUS PILOTS TO DEPART TO THE SOUTH AND MAKE A NORMAL RIGHT CLIMBING TURN. DURING THE CLIMB TO THE SOUTHWEST, THE WITNESSES HEARD THE ENGINE SURGE AND STOP. THE AIRCRAFT WAS SEEN TO LEVEL AND DESCEND AS IT CONTINUED THE RIGHT TURN BACK TOWARD THE AIRPORT. IT WAS OBSERVED TO STALL AT APPROXIMATELY 100 FEET AGL PRIOR TO IMPACTING INTO THE OPEN FIELD ADJACENT THE DEPARTURE END OF THE RUNWAY. THE PILOT HAD NOT SUMPED THE FUEL SYSTEM DURING THE AIRCRAFT PRE-FLIGHT. WATER WAS FOUND IN THE FUEL SYSTEM AND POWERPLANT DURING THE INVESTIGATION.
